Output eff21680e3810257f256adf7cdf69cfc9c7be22ae0c3290421ae7d96e74943b0:1

value
85723445
script pubkey
OP_0 OP_PUSHBYTES_20 4fc717c495cc9d749ff52e79c0209643d9a44dcb
address
ltc1qflr303y4ejwhf8l49euuqgykg0v6gnwtsj8az6
transaction
eff21680e3810257f256adf7cdf69cfc9c7be22ae0c3290421ae7d96e74943b0
spent
true